Founded in 1963, ECCO is a Danish footwear and leather goods brand known for perfectly combining comfort and style. With North America and Asia as its primary markets, ECCO has over 14,000 points of sale across more than 80 countries and regions worldwide. Since entering China in 1997, ECCO has expanded to over 1,000 points of sale domestically and actively developed its online presence, opening flagship stores on its official website as well as major e-commerce platforms including JD.com and Tmall.
iPad POS – Elevating the In-Store Customer Experience
For brick-and-mortar shoe stores, traditional bulky cash registers are gradually becoming a thing of the past. ECCO stores have kept pace with the times by adopting the Damai iPad POS system. Beyond core functions such as scan-to-order, pre-orders and pre-sales, order hold, order-on-behalf, inbound/outbound document management, and inventory counting, it delivers a qualitative leap in the customer shopping experience.
Sales associates can leverage the Damai iPad's high-definition screen and intuitive interface to vividly showcase product colors, styling combinations, and similar styles to customers. Shoppers can browse and select their desired items more conveniently and intuitively, enhancing the overall shopping experience and satisfaction.
O2O Store Pickup – Seamlessly Bridging Online and Offline
For a brand like ECCO that operates both online and offline, integrating physical stores into online business cooperation is an effective way to drive growth and cultivate more consumers. By blending online and offline retail models, consumers can browse products, place orders, and complete payment online, then choose to pick up their purchases at a nearby physical store. This O2O model preserves the convenience of online shopping while delivering the experiential feel of in-store purchasing.
Beyond meeting ECCO's basic O2O business model requirements, the Burgeon system can also intelligently assign online orders to the nearest store for fulfillment based on optimized selection rules, effectively resolving issues of high fulfillment logistics costs and poor delivery timeliness caused by dispersed inventory across stores.
Out-of-Stock Order Fulfillment – Capturing Every Sales Opportunity
Out-of-stock situations in stores are a major factor impacting sales performance. For footwear and apparel brands especially, popular products frequently face color or size shortages, compromising the customer shopping experience while directly resulting in lost sales opportunities.
To effectively address this issue, ECCO introduced the Burgeon Cloud Warehouse system. Sales associates can view cloud warehouse inventory in real time, gaining full visibility into stock levels across all stores. When a store is out of stock, they can immediately place an order through the cloud warehouse system to transfer inventory from another store for customer delivery. The application of the cloud warehouse system not only helps ECCO meet consumer demand more efficiently but also improves inventory turnover, ensuring no sales opportunity is missed.
